What does outdoor power supply volts refer to
In the United States, outdoor outlets predominantly function at a voltage of 120 volts, which is consistent with indoor outlets. This voltage rating is designed to power a variety of common outdoor devices such as power tools, garden lights, and seasonal decorations effectively. But why does this matter? Let's break it down. Common voltages for these systems typically include 12V, 24V, and 48V, catering to different needs and. . “V” stands for volts – the unit used to measure voltage, or how much electrical pressure is being pushed through a circuit. Think of voltage like water pressure in a hose: the higher the pressure, the more energy is available to power a device. 6 amps, but what does that mean? What are the outdoor power supply points included
Outdoor Powerpoints are weatherproof electrical outlets that are meant to resist the external environment of rain, dust, and temperature variation, as opposed to standard indoor outlets which only offer dust and moisture protection. This manual is a complete guide for outdoor power outlets, their functions, basic features, and proper installation. Comprehending these factors will help you ensure that all your. . These power points allow you to run yard equipment without using extension cords. They usually have covers or casings to protect against environmental factors, making them safe to use, even in unforgiving. . Outdoor power distribution units (PDUs) are crucial components for ensuring a safe and reliable supply of electricity in outdoor environments, such as construction sites, parks, events, and gardens.
